Motorized spinal decompression vs surgery: different goals, evidence and urgency

Motorized decompression and spinal surgery are not interchangeable versions of one treatment. One applies external forces; the other removes, enlarges, stabilizes or reconstructs structures under operative conditions.

The comparison only makes sense after the diagnosis is defined. Stable disc-related pain is fundamentally different from cauda equina syndrome, progressive foot drop, severe stenosis or instability.

What each option is intended to do

Motorized decompression applies external distraction forces and does not remove disc material, enlarge bone or stabilize an unstable segment.

Surgery is diagnosis-specific: discectomy removes herniated material, laminectomy or foraminotomy enlarges neural space, and fusion addresses selected instability.

Why urgency changes the comparison

A person with stable pain and no major deficit may explore non-surgical care. Progressive motor loss or cauda equina signs are different.

A surgical consultation does not guarantee surgery; it clarifies whether direct decompression may outweigh its risks.

Clinical situationRole of non-surgical careRole of surgical opinion
Stable symptoms without major deficitOften reasonable initially.Elective if symptoms persist and imaging correlates.
Persistent severe radicular painMay be tried if safe and measurable.Consider if non-surgical care fails.
Progressive weakness or cauda equinaMust not delay urgent evaluation.Urgent or emergency pathway may be required.

Comparing outcomes honestly

Surgery can provide faster or greater relief in selected structural radiculopathy or stenosis, but carries anaesthetic, infection, dural, neurological and reoperation risks.

Evidence for generic traction is weak and evidence for proprietary decompression protocols is limited. Decompression should not be marketed as equivalent to surgical decompression.

Shared decision-making before surgery

A surgical discussion should review natural history, expected benefit, alternatives, urgency, complications, recovery and the risk of delay.

A non-surgical trial should have goals and stop rules. Neurological deterioration should trigger reassessment rather than automatic extension.

  • Ask which operation is proposed and what it treats.
  • Clarify whether the goal is pain, neurological recovery, walking or stability.
  • Discuss how duration of weakness may influence recovery.
  • Do not treat temporary pain relief as proof of neurological safety.

Questions to ask before choosing care

Before beginning care for motorized spinal decompression vs surgery, ask the provider to explain the working diagnosis and the findings that support it. The discussion should distinguish a structural description from the clinical syndrome, clarify whether neurological function is stable and identify the specific outcome the treatment is intended to improve.

A high-quality plan also explains the expected timeline, reasonable alternatives, possible harms, cost and the criteria for changing course. No treatment should continue indefinitely because it produced a brief change in pain. The decision should be reviewed against measurable function and safety.

How to monitor progress

Progress should be tracked with more than a pain score. Useful measures include how far symptoms travel, strength, sensation, walking tolerance, sleep, medication use and the ability to perform meaningful activities. Neurological change should always be documented separately from pain relief.

Temporary fluctuations are common. The important question is whether the overall trajectory is safer and more functional. New weakness, expanding numbness, altered bladder or bowel function or a substantial loss of walking ability should trigger reassessment rather than automatic continuation of the same treatment.
